Toddler
chalkboard!
Chalkboards are great for practicing letters, shapes
and numbers. Here's an activity for you and your toddler
to make a fun toddler chalkboard, that might even turn
into a gift for a relative. You'll need a craft
chalkboard from a craft store that has a wooden frame.
(The photo used a board that is about 7 inches by 6
inches.) Then with some neat craft scissors cut out all
sorts of strips of different colored construction paper.
Then take some glue and apply it to one side of the wood
frame. Let your toddler put some of the strips of paper
over to cover up the wood. Then move on to the next
side. When you have completed all four sides, you'll
have a wonderfully colored masterpiece! You can attach
some string to the back to hang it on the wall if you
like!
Supplies Needed-
- craft chalkboard
- craft scissors
- construction paper
- glue
Tips/Suggestions-
- Talk about the different colors your toddler is
putting on the frame
- This will make a great gift for that special relative
or friend, just in time for the holidays!
